At mPharma, we start and end our day thinking about how we can enable patients to afford their medications. We are a small but growing team of 500+ members, headquartered in Accra, Ghana, backed by world-class investors. We’ve joined hands with third-party payers, drug manufacturers, and healthcare providers to develop products and services that directly reduce the costs of prescription drugs for patients. In only a few months, we’ve managed to provide low-cost, high-quality medicines to tens of thousands of patients across 9 African countries.

Position Description

As a Staff Data Engineer at mPharma, you will work on an autonomous squad of engineers, product managers, and designers that decide what needs to be built and how to build it. Each day Data Engineers at mPharma are working on problems like how to create complex data enrichment pipelines, how to use computer vision to enhance the onboarding experience, or how to present to the team the wonders of Spark.

Furthermore, we believe that engineers play a critical role in the product definition, so you will work with product managers and designers to determine how to solve real problems that real people have. At the end of the day, mPharma believes in people, and in addition to being highly skilled, our team is collaborative and welcoming. We are looking for engineers who want to grow the company, themselves, and their colleagues. The role comes with an option of hybrid or fully remote.

Key Responsibilities

  • Build, manage and document automated data pipelines.
  • Perform integrations between complex systems.
  • Ensure the implementation of data warehousing optimization techniques.
  • Discover bottlenecks in our data infrastructure and provide effective solutions.

Ideal Candidate

  • You are a smart, kind, team player that wants to innovate while building value.
  • You are comfortable writing Scala, Java or Python.
  • You are experienced with modern infrastructure and tooling.
  • You love best practices in your area of expertise.
  • You believe in practices like data provenance, automated testing, and continuous delivery.
  • You are comfortable with designing and building scalable, distributed systems.
  • You know how to apply data structures and algorithms to real-world problems.
  • You are great at writing SQL queries.
  • You are comfortable with Infrastructure as Code tools like Terraform.
  • You are comfortable with an event streaming technology like Kafka.

Qualifications

  • 3+ years of relevant software development experience building software applications.
  • At least 2 years of experience in software development and software data engineering.
  • Experience with data modelling and data warehousing techniques is required.
  • Experience with data quality checks is required.
  • Experience with event-driven architecture is required.
  • Experience working with cloud services like AWS, GCP or Azure is required.
  • Preferably educational background in computer science, software engineering, information technology, or any related field.
